The other gift that Lou Ann gave us was a cute little yellow onesy with ducks on it! Our first baby outfit! Oh my gosh! I'm going to have a baby! In presenting the outfit to us, she mentioned the two rules for shopping for baby clothes:

1. NEVER buy baby clothes that do not unbutton around the legs. If you have to pull the pants on/off the baby, the clothes will only end up staying in the closet. Too much of a hassle.

2. ALWAYS stick your hand inside the clothes before buying them. There are lots of baby clothes that look super fancy and soft on the outside, only to have a plastic-y feeling on the inside.
